This document discusses a study on using iron filings to adsorb methylene blue dye from aqueous solutions. Twenty-five batch and continuous experiments were conducted at different dye concentrations, iron filing amounts, and flow rates. Batch experiments showed the adsorption capacity was 24.47 mg/g for untreated iron filings and 25.03 mg/g for treated iron filings, both fitting the Langmuir isotherm model well. Column experiments found continuous flow adsorption of the dye was feasible but efficiency decreased over long term operation due to changes in column properties and reaction kinetics.
